The transcript discusses the current state of GE's stock, which is seen as undervalued despite mediocre performance compared to Honeywell. GE's turnaround efforts are hindered by challenges in the power market, though other sectors like aerospace and healthcare are stable. The discussion highlights the strategic differences between GE and Honeywell, attributing Honeywell's success to better management decisions under Dave Cody compared to Jeff Immelt's era at GE.
